## Driftwood Sweeper: Environments

The Driftwood sweeper scans the Calloway platform for orphaned resources — detached volumes, expired snapshots, and abandoned test namespaces — and deletes them after a grace period. It runs in three environments: dev, staging, and prod, each with its own scan interval and deletion policy. Future maintainers should note that prod deletion is gated behind a dry-run flag that must be explicitly disabled. The prod configuration is shown below.

deployment values, kajep-kageg:
[praix]
host = praix.paliqcorp.corp
user = praix_svc
database = praix_prod

## Service Accounts — Scrubjay EXIF Pipeline

Scrubjay strips EXIF from all uploads before they hit the Plover CDN. It runs under the svc-scrubjay account; do not run it as yourself. If the queue backs up, restart the worker pool, not the account. On-call may need to re-auth the worker manually after a restart. The current service key for svc-scrubjay follows.

app token of bahaf-tajeg = zpat23_SjjsllwiLmXbtS65veZaV47

Subject: Handover — export retry queue

Hi Dalia,

Quick handover before I'm out. The retry worker for failed exports in Plumeway is stable again; failures now requeue with exponential backoff, capped at five attempts. Plugin authors should note that partial exports are no longer resumed — they restart from scratch. Docs are updated on the partner wiki. Anyone signing retry manifests for third-party plugins needs the current signing key, included here for reference.

rollout seal: bky9_PeXH1fTLY